## Vendor Note: Measurekind Scaling Module

The recipe-scaling calculator bundled with Grainfield Kitchen is supplied by an external vendor, Measurekind, under a support contract renewed annually. Plugin authors should not patch the scaling module directly; defects and feature requests are routed through our vendor liaison, who tracks them against the contract's response terms. Include reproduction steps and affected recipe yields when reporting. Submit all Measurekind-related issues to the liaison desk at the address below.

alerts address for kajog-tadup: druox@plorvanet.internal

Onboarding note for the release manager — Crumbline order-cutoff rule. The bakery platform enforces a hard cutoff at 14:00 local store time; orders after that roll to the next baking day. The cutoff is evaluated at checkout, not at payment capture, so a release must never ship between 13:45 and 14:15 or in-flight carts may straddle the boundary. The release-gate config is sealed; to edit the cutoff window, unlock it with the recovery passphrase below.

strongbox words: sormir-sorael-rusax

Locker access flow for Tumblevault plugins: your plugin requests a drop-off token, the resident scans it at the kiosk, and the assigned locker unlatches for 90 seconds. Tokens are single-use and expire after 15 minutes; always handle the expiry callback rather than retrying blindly. The complete token lifecycle and kiosk event reference are documented on the page below.

wiki page, tahaf-tajog: https://jira.ordindyn.corp/pipeline